Sramanism - Influence On Hinduism

Influence On Hinduism

Sramana gave rise to several elements which were subsequently adopted by several Indian religions. The concept of the cycle of birth and death, the concept of samsara, the concept of liberation and yoga are ultimately from Sramana. The Hindu ashrama system of life was an attempt to institutionalize Shramana ideals within the Brahmanical social structure. The Shramana movement also influenced the Aranyakas and Upanishads in the Brahmanical tradition.
